Press Christmas for All needs you
Donations are down.
Time is almost up.
Panic? Not a chance.
As of Thursday, Press Christmas for All had raised just two-thirds of its $185,000 goal. That included $10,000 from the program’s largest donor, Anonymous in Athol, and an unexpectedly generous $7,500 from the team at Trindera Engineering. Several large, traditional donors had not been heard from as the final hours of the 2016 campaign were winding down.
But this is the season of miracles, so Press Christmas for All volunteers remain enthusiastically hopeful some of Kootenai County’s greatest champions for the needy are simply saving the best for last.
That means today.
The Coeur d’Alene Press will be open from 8 a.m. to 5 p.m. today for donations to be dropped off at the front desk, 215 N. Second St. in downtown Coeur d’Alene. Donations by credit card can be made by calling The Press at (208) 664-8176. All donations are tax-deductible.
If you’ve got a little miracle up your sleeve, please share it today. Press Christmas for All is assisting more than 7,300 Kootenai County residents this holiday season. Your donation of any size will help.
